The OpportunityAt Universal Avionics, we develop advanced avionics, enhanced vision systems, and intelligent cockpit technologies that improve aviation safety and situational awareness worldwide.
For more than 40 years, Universal Avionics has been a trusted innovator in aerospace technology, supporting commercial airlines, business aviation, cargo operations, and special mission aircraft around the globe. As part of Elbit Systems, we combine the agility of a collaborative engineering organization with the strength and global reach of a leading aerospace and defense company.
Our Duluth, Georgia site is home to engineering, IT, and cross-functional teams developing and supporting the next generation of connected avionics technologies. As a Computer Technical Support Intern, you'll support the technology that keeps our teams productive from resolving hardware and software issues to assisting with system deployments, user support, and enterprise IT operations. This internship is designed to provide practical experience while helping you build a strong foundation for a career in Information Technology.
What You'll DoProvide first-line technical support for employees across a variety of hardware, software, and business applications
Troubleshoot desktop, laptop, printer, mobile device, and connectivity issues while delivering excellent customer service
Assist with new computer deployments, software installations, system configurations, and user setup
Help maintain accurate documentation, service tickets, and IT asset information
Support troubleshooting efforts by diagnosing technical issues and identifying practical solutions
Collaborate with experienced IT professionals on more complex technical challenges
Assist with server administration, user account management, and remote access support
Participate in software testing, upgrades, and technology improvement initiatives
